hu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]Ubuntu 下使用 Hugo 搭建静态网站的全过程指南|ubuntu静态网络配置,Ubuntu Hugo 静态网站,Ubuntu环境下利用Hugo搭建静态网站的详细教程与实践

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文详细介绍了在Ubuntu操作系统下使用Hugo搭建静态网站全过程。从Ubuntu静态网络配置入手,逐步讲解了如何安装Hugo、创建新网站、配置网站参数、添加内容以及生成并部署网站,为用户提供了全面的指南。

本文目录导读:

  1. 安装 Hugo
  2. 创建新网站
  3. 部署网站

随着互联网技术的不断发展,静态网站因其快速、安全、易于部署等优势,逐渐成为许多开发者和企业的新选择,Hugo 是一个流行的静态网站生成器,它基于 Go 语言开发,具有高性能和灵活性,本文将详细介绍如何在 Ubuntu 系统下使用 Hugo 搭建静态网站。

安装 Hugo

1、更新系统软件包

确保你的 Ubuntu 系统已更新到最新版本,在终端中输入以下命令:

sudo apt update
sudo apt upgrade

2、安装 Hugo

安装 Hugo,你可以从 Hugo 的官方网站下载最新版本的安装包,或者使用以下命令安装:

sudo apt install hugo

安装完成后,输入以下命令查看 Hugo 的版本,以确保安装成功:

hugo version

创建新网站

1、创建新站点

在终端中,输入以下命令创建一个新的 Hugo 站点:

hugo new site mysite

这里,mysite 是你站点的名称,你可以根据需要更改它。

2、添加主题

Hugo 提供了丰富的主题,你可以从 Hugo 的主题库中选择一个适合你的主题,这里我们以ananke 主题为例,输入以下命令将其添加到你的站点:

cd mysite
git clone https://github.com/theant/chinese-ananke-theme.git themes/ananke

3、配置主题

ananke 主题的配置文件config.toml 拷贝到你的站点根目录下,并对其进行修改,以满足你的需求。

cp themes/ananke/config.toml .

4、添加内容

content 目录下,创建你的文章和页面,创建一个名为about.md 的关于页面:

hugo new about.md

about.md 文件中添加以下内容:


title: "quot;
date: 2021-10-01T08:00:00+08:00
draft: false

这里是关于页面的内容...

5、生成静态网站

在终端中,输入以下命令生成静态网站:

hugo

执行完成后,你会在public 目录下找到生成的静态网站文件。

部署网站

1、上传到服务器

将生成的静态网站文件上传到你的服务器,你可以使用scpftp 或其他工具进行上传。

2、配置服务器

在服务器上,创建一个新的目录,将上传的静态网站文件移动到该目录下,配置 Web 服务器(如 Apache、Nginx)以托管这些文件。

以 Apache 为例,编辑/etc/apache2/sites-available/yourdomain.conf 文件,添加以下内容:

<VirtualHost *:80>
    ServerName yourdomain.com
    ServerAlias www.yourdomain.com
    DocumentRoot /var/www/yourdomain/public
    <Directory /var/www/yourdomain/public>
        Options Indexes FollowSymLinks
        AllowOverride All
        Require all granted
    </Directory>
</VirtualHost>

保存并关闭文件,然后重启 Apache 服务器:

sudo systemctl restart apache2

3、访问网站

你可以通过域名访问你的静态网站了。

本文详细介绍了在 Ubuntu 系统下使用 Hugo 搭建静态网站的过程,通过这个过程,你可以快速搭建一个性能优越、易于维护的静态网站,Hugo 的强大功能和丰富的主题库,将为你的网站开发提供更多可能性。

相关关键词:

Ubuntu, Hugo, 静态网站, 网站搭建, 安装 Hugo, 创建新站点, 添加主题, 配置主题, 添加内容, 生成静态网站, 部署网站, 服务器配置, Apache, Nginx, 域名解析, 网站访问, 性能优化, 网站维护, Hugo 主题库, 网站开发, 网站部署, 服务器托管, 静态网站生成器, Go 语言, 网站速度, 网站安全, 网站备份, 网站迁移, 网站优化, 网站监控, 网站分析, 网站推广, 网站SEO, 网站内容管理, 网站设计, 网站开发工具, 网站开发框架, 网站开发教程, 网站开发经验, 网站开发社区, 网站开发资源, 网站开发交流, 网站开发心得, 网站开发案例, 网站开发趋势, 网站开发前景, 网站开发方向, 网站开发技巧

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

静态网站搭建建立静态网站

Ubuntu Hugo 静态网站:ubuntu静态网络配置

原文链接:,转发请注明来源!